Something i have been kicking around lately is the idea of creating a sign or bumper sticker to advertise Blue Bucket Radio which in turn will drum up listeners.

If i was going to do this, i would have a sign shop make a sign that goes in our yard, kind of like those annoying political posters with rods that anchor the sign in the dirt.

Besides word of mouth, how have you advertised your station to bring listeners to your end of the dial?

Ya, that could work but only if it's in your coverage area. If you are driving around somewhere the car behind would see but not be able to find it on the radio.

How would you tell them only in this little area where you live.

Do you have a community mail box where you are? that's what I do to advertise mine....a poster on the mail box up the street.
